The college in Solapur, Maharashtra, India, boasts good infrastructure and a supportive campus environment, with no ragging issues and adequate hostel facilities. There are approximately 80 faculty members, all qualified doctors aged between 30 and 45, holding either MD or MS degrees. The faculty is well-qualified and experienced, demonstrating good command over their subjects and providing encouragement and support to students.
Teaching methods primarily involve slideshow presentations, which some students find unengaging, though clinical postings are considered interesting and provide valuable exposure to medical practice. The college maintains strong academic standards with structured assessments, including two internal exams, a prelim exam, weekly tests, and post-end exams. The library serves as an effective study resource, and the faculty is approachable and polite.
